We are going to remove bs->job pointer. Drop it's usage in blk_iostatus_reset. blk_iostatus_reset() has only two callers: 1. blk_attach_dev(). This doesn't have anything to do with jobs and attaching a new guest device won't solve any problem the job encountered, so no reason to reset the iostatus for the job. 2. qmp_cont(). This resets the iostatus for everything. We can just call block_job_iostatus_reset() for all block jobs instead of going through BlockBackend.
